Completed in 1667 and located in front of the church of Santa Maria Sopra Minerva in Rome, Italy, Bernini's "Elephant" is a powerful symbol combining Egyptian lore and Roman power. The elephant was designed as an imaginative base for the ancient Egyptian obelisk from the 6th century BCE.
